Which is the oldest 'Yota that you can still buy new in 2024? The answer is Land Cruiser 70, which came out in 1984 as the successor to the 40 series.
Toyota last updated the 70 series in August 2023 for MY24, giving the body-on-frame model the 2.8-liter turbo diesel inline-four engine from the Hilux. Japan's largest automaker – and in the world, for that matter – also worked its magic in terms of exterior design, interior tech, and safety features.

The good folks at CarExpert Australia have recently drag raced a couple of refreshed 70s against each other (a V8 wagon and an I4 ute) and a Hilux with the aforementioned 2.8-liter turbo diesel. Which is quickest from a dig? The short answer is Hilux, but you'll be surprised how close the four-pot Land Cruiser 70 pickup truck is to the far more modern Hilux SR5 Double Cab.

The single-cabbed and tray-equipped LC79 clocked 11.80 seconds to 100 kilometers per hour (62 miles per hour) and 17.73 in the quarter mile, whereas the Hilux required 11.17 and 17.70 seconds. The LC76 sport utility vehicle, which features the much larger V8 engine, posted 14.62 and 19.28 seconds.

These said, bear in mind the LC76 isn't as torquey as the LC79 and Hilux. Its 4.5-liter turbo diesel V8 pumps out 151 kW and 430 Nm of torque, meaning 202 horsepower and 317 pound-feet. As for the 2.8-liter turbo diesel I4, the numbers are 150 kW and 500 Nm (201 horsepower and 369 pound-feet).

Part of the reason why the V8 isn't up to snuff concerns the sheer age of the 1VD-FTV, which is the only member of the VD engine family. It came out in 2007, and the punchiest version to date produces 210 kW (282 horsepower) at 3,400 revolutions per minute and 650 Nm (479 pound-feet) at 1,600 revolutions per minute. Said version is a twin-turbo affair. The 70 features one turbo.

Weighing down the LC79 and Hilux to match the curb weight of the LC76 resulted in – obviously enough – worse numbers. CarExpert Australia reports 12.71 and 18.28 seconds for the I4-powered 70 series compared to 12.95 and 18.46 seconds for the Hilux. Following the dig races, the boyos decided to test these 'Yotas from a roll. First at 40 kilometers per hour (that's 25 miles per hour), then at 50 kilometers per hour (31 miles per hour).

With the transmissions in third gear at the start, the Hilux made easy work of the 70 series ute and wagon. The four-pot LC79 proved slower than the eight-cylinder LC76, finishing last in both races. At the end of the day, however, the LC70 and Hilux weren't designed for straight-line performance.

For MY24, the LC76 with the 4.5-liter diesel carries a sticker price of 83,900 kangaroo bucks (around 54,670 freedom eagles). The single-cabbed LC79 is 78,900 for the four-pot diesel and 82,900 for the V8, whereas the Hilux can be had for as little as 40,985 with the Single Cab, 45,665 for the Extra Cab, or 48,235 for the Dual Cab in Workmate 4x4 flavor.
